Understanding ADHD and the Need for Diagnosis
ADHD is identified by a consistent pattern of inattention and/or hyperactivity-impulsivity that hinders working or advancement. Although the specific causes stay unclear, genetics, environment, and brain structure are thought to play a role.
Value of Diagnosis
A formal diagnosis of ADHD can pave the way for reliable management and assistance techniques. It is vital for:
Accessing treatment choices (medication, treatment, and so on)Understanding personal challengesEnhancing coping strategies in academic or occupational settingsThe Process of Private Diagnosis for ADHDAction 1: Initial Consultation
The journey normally begins with a preliminary assessment with a qualified health care expert, such as a psychiatrist or psychologist. This meeting intends to discuss signs, medical history, and any previous assessments.
Action 2: Comprehensive Assessment
Throughout the assessment stage, practitioners will conduct:
Clinical interviews: Discussing history and behaviourStandardized rating scales: Utilized to examine sign severityObservational assessments: Noting behaviour in various settingsAction 3: Feedback Session
After the assessments are finished, a feedback session is arranged. Here, the health care service provider will talk about the results, offer the diagnosis (if relevant), and recommend management methods.
Step 4: Follow-Up Care
Post-diagnosis, individuals can gain from follow-up appointments to keep an eye on development and make any necessary modifications to treatment.

Just how much does a private ADHD diagnosis cost?
The cost for a private ADHD diagnosis can differ widely, ranging from ₤ 300 to ₤ 1,500 depending on the level of the assessments, area, and specific services provided.
2. For how long does the assessment take?
The assessment normally lasts from one to 3 hours, depending on the person's requirements and the specific tests administered. Follow-up sessions might also be required.
3. Is a private diagnosis valid?
Yes, a valid diagnosis from a certified professional is acknowledged by health care systems and universities. Last but not least, it's vital to guarantee the specialist is accredited and follows standardized assessment procedures.
4. Can I receive treatment from the very same provider?
The majority of private diagnosis clinics also supply treatment services, consisting of medication management, therapy, and support groups. It's advisable to ask during the initial assessment.
